e.g.6 In how many distinct arrangements can we arrange the
letters a, b and c?

n=3
n! = n(n-1)(n-2)…(2)(1)
n! = 3(3-1)(3-2) = 3(2)(1)
n! = 6

Circular Permutations
 Permutations that occur by arranging objects in a circle.

Theorem 3:
The number of permutations of n objects
arranged in a circle is (n – 1)!

e.g.10 In how many ways can 7 graduate students be assigned


to 1 triple and 2 double hotel rooms during a conference? 210

e.g.11 How many different letter arrangements can be made


from the letters in the word STATISTICS? 50,400
